The Ogun State Police Command has arrested controversial musician Habeeb Okikiola, popularly known as Portable, again, and ordered an investigation into a viral video showing his alleged assault while in custody.

The Command’s Public Relations Officer, Mr Oluseyi Babaseyi who confirmed the arrest, said Portable was currently being detained by the police, but described the actions seen in the circulating video as unacceptable and contrary to police standards.

Mr Babaseyi condemned the alleged beating of the handcuffed suspect and the filming of suspects in custody, stressing that the police do not permit such conduct under any circumstance.

The police spokesperson assured that the Command had ordered a full investigation into the incident captured in the video, adding that appropriate action would be taken against any personnel found culpable.

Although the reason for Portable’s arrest was yet to be disclosed as at the time of filing this report, it would be recalled that he was recently involved in a violent scuffle with one of his wives and other family members.

Fast-rising and street-hop artiste, Habeeb Okikiola, popularly known as Portable has welcomed his fourth child with third ‘baby mama’.

The 27-year-old Sango Ota-based singer shared a picture of his baby mama’s bump and a video of the newborn on his Instagram page.

The Zazu crooner said the birth of the baby was a double celebration for him as the day marked his first anniversary in the music industry.

Recall that Portable rose to fame and marked his entrance into the spotlight on December 10, 2021, after Poco Lee introduced him to Olamide which brought about the collabo for his hit single, “Zazzu Zeh”.

The leader of the Zeh nation movement revealed the child’s name as Akorede Omolalomi Badmus.

“Thank u lord for the Gift of Life. Akorede Omolalomi Badmus. It’s a new bouncing baby boy. Congrats to myself and the mother @honey_berry25 Iyawo IKA. December 10th de day real fame came & same Dec 10th I welcomed a new baby boi. God no dey disappoint,” Portable wrote.

Reports say that the baby is the second from Portable this year, the singer had one in early June with his wife and also shared another news in November that he’s expecting another baby soon.

The Ogun State Police Command, on Monday, ordered the popular Zazoo crooner, Habeeb Okikiola popularly called ‘Portable’ to report himself to any nearest police station, over an allegation of inhuman treatment as contained in a video said to have gone viral.

The Command, in a release issued by its spokesman, DSP Abimbola Oyeyemi disclosed that failure of ‘Portable’ to submit himself to the police, means that his arrest would promptly be ordered.

The hip-hop musician in the viral video was alleged to have organised some youths to beat up a man and inflict great bodily injury on the person.

“The sad incident was alleged to have happened somewhere in Ogun State over the weekend”.

The police disclosed that “such barbaric act is very unbecoming of a decent human being or someone serving as a role model to the youths and that the earlier such sadistic tendencies are dealt with in accordance with the law of the land, the better before the youth begin to emulate such condemnable acts”.

The release read, “the attention of Ogun State Police Command has been drawn to a video clip circulating on social media where a popular hip hop musician, Habeeb Okikiola a.k.a Portable, the Zazu crooner was seen organizing some youths to beat up a young man and inflict bodily injury on him.

“The incident was said to have taken place somewhere within Ogun State about two days ago”.

“Such unruly and violent behavior is not only barbaric, but unbecoming of somebody who supposed to be a role model for the youths and therefore should not be tolerated”.

“In view of this, the Command is using this medium to advise Okikiola Habeeb a.k.a Portable to report himself at the nearest police station in Ogun State, failure of which his arrest will be ordered.

“The flagrant display of impunity by portable in the viral video is condemnable and if not checked, it will send a wrong signal to the youths who are looking up to him as a role model.
